First, think about your character's origin. Were they born into a noble family or in the slums? For example, if from the slums, they might have a gritty backstory of survival against crime and poverty. Second, consider their motivation. Maybe they witnessed a heretical act and are now driven to root out heresy. Finally, add some personal quirks, like a fear of the dark due to a past encounter in a dark alleyway.

To create compelling fantasy interactive stories, first, develop a rich and unique fantasy world with its own rules, cultures, and magic systems. Then, create interesting characters with distinct personalities and goals. Next, plan out different story branches based on the choices the reader can make. For example, if the story is about a hero's quest, one choice could lead to a dangerous battle while another could lead to a diplomatic encounter. Also, use vivid descriptions to bring the fantasy world to life, like describing the enchanted forest with its glowing plants and strange creatures.
